【電車でGO!プロフェッショナル仕様】描画距離を伸ばしてみた2

Published on ● Video Link: https://www.youtube.com/watch?v=qOkfnnllyqI



Duration: 15:30
1,460 views
41


ポリゴン情報?を拡張RAM領域に格納できるようになったおかげで、描画距離を伸ばしたりマップオブジェクトのLODモデルを無効化したりしてもオブジェクトが欠けたりフリーズしたりしなくなりました
まぁ処理落ちはするんですけどね

コード(DuckStation用)
ポリゴン情報を拡張RAM領域に格納
A1210E6C 3C028006
80044CFE 1400
A1210E6C 3C028006
80044E76 1400
A1210E6C 3C028006
800454BE 1400
A1210E6C 3C028006
80045B16 1400
A1210E6C 3C028006
9005B318 80200000
A1210E6C 3C028006
9005B32C 80500000
ゲームを起動する前に「8 MB RAM を有効にする」にチェックを入れてね(起動中にチェックを入れても反映されないので注意)

一部オブジェクトの描画距離を伸ばす
A70176C8 FFFF0140

線路のLODモデルほぼ無効化
A70172A0 00050001
A70172B0 00040001
A70172C0 00030001
A70172D8 00020001
A70172F0 00020001
A70172FC 00030001
A7017308 00040001
A7017314 00050001
A7017690 0090FFFF
A7017692 27A53C05

マップオブジェクトのLODモデル無効化
A70180B0 00020001
A70180C0 00040001
A70180CC 00060001